Then I went to my yarn club where I embroidered. Well, I crocheted a little--last month Genevieve had started an experimental project of knitting with embroidery floss, so I had started wondering if you could crochet with it, too. So I got a skein of one of DMC's new colors (Very Dark Cornflower Blue, which really does look like the exact shade of my favorite kind of bachelor buttons) and found a motif that looked like a bachelor button and it came out looking really nice. (If anyone reading this is wondering, I used all six strands together and a B hook.)
